Small Garden Landscaping in Ventura County, CA
Small garden landscaping services focus on enhancing the appearance and functionality of residential outdoor spaces through a variety of projects. These services often include planting new flower beds, installing decorative edging, adding pathways, and creating inviting patios or seating areas. Property owners typically seek these services to improve curb appeal, create a more enjoyable outdoor environment, or prepare their gardens for seasonal changes. Before requesting landscaping assistance, homeowners should consider the size of their garden, the types of plants or features they desire, and any specific design preferences or budget constraints.
Understanding the scope of small garden landscaping projects can help property owners communicate their needs effectively. Common requests include upgrading existing garden beds, incorporating low-maintenance plants, or adding simple features like lighting or small water elements. It’s helpful to have an idea of the desired style-whether modern, traditional, or natural-and to consider the overall layout of the yard. Clarifying these details in advance can ensure the landscaping services align with the homeowner’s vision for their outdoor space.

Common Small Garden Landscaping Jobs
Garden bed installation - creating defined planting areas to enhance curb appeal.
Lawn edging and trimming - maintaining clean lines around grass and garden features.
Pathway and patio design - adding functional and attractive hardscape surfaces.
Plant selection and placement - choosing suitable plants to suit the garden space.
Outdoor lighting setup - illuminating pathways and garden features for safety and ambiance.
Small tree and shrub pruning - promoting healthy growth and tidy appearance.
Small Garden Landscaping Questions
What types of small garden landscaping projects are common? Typical projects include garden beds, pathways, small patios, and turf installation to enhance outdoor spaces.
How can small garden landscaping improve a property’s appearance? It adds visual interest, defines outdoor areas, and increases curb appeal with thoughtful plantings and design features.
What should homeowners consider before starting a small garden project? Consider the existing space, sunlight exposure, and desired use to select suitable plants and design elements.
Are there options to customize small garden landscapes? Yes, options include choosing different plant varieties, hardscape materials, and layout styles to match personal preferences.
